Hi - hoping someone might have some insight into whether what I want to do is possible. I have an existing Pentair SolarTouch that's on its own circuit and simply exists to turn the actuator value open/closed if there is heat available on the solar. That's how it was setup when I bought this house. The pool pump is currently a single speed that's starting to bleed us dry with power consumption. Looking to replace that with a B&D Variable Speed... and looking into whether or not the SolarTouch relay can support the B&D. I know the B&D automation board doesn't interface with the RS-485, but I did see where the SolarTouch has a separate SPST Relay... obviously I wouldn't wire that to the B&D automation board unless I want to fry everything and electrocute myself, however, is there any way at all to get the SolarTouch to override the B&D's schedule when there is solar heat available?

Members have has problems making the automation adapter work.

Spend a bit more and make your life easier and get an IntelliFlo pump that is compatible with your Solartouch.
